Site Architecture:
Ever seen links like this?www.mywebsite.com/index.php?content=3245w4563456&visitorID=84hgoe854g495uy9u5hg95hgigh8594rtyutm&size=10 ? Hard to read arent they? They are hard to understand too because they don't make good use of human language. Well search engines have the same problem in understanding and matching your pages to keywords. Believe it or not you can put keywords in your URLs so the above link becomes: www.mywebsite.com/shelas-shoes-uk/size10 Much better! Now when someone searches for "shelas shoes size 10", the search engines know that your website has just the thing.

The way your site links together and the pathway that people and search engines must take to find information are very important. We will make sure that your site is properly linked together, and that all the information on your site is easy to find. For example: all your information should be within 2-3 clicks from the home page. The address of your sites internel pages are also in plain english. Explain!
